316L Stainless Steel Balls
Profile:The 316L stainless ball is made of ultra-low carbon austenitic stainless steel, with molybdenum added to enhance resistance to pitting and crevice corrosion, and is resistant to acids, alkalis, and extreme temperatures. After solid solution treatment, it is non-magnetic and has excellent ductility, making it suitable for high-purity fluid systems, nuclear power equipment, and food processing fields, meeting the needs for long-term stability in harsh environments.
